What Causes This Problem
- Smoke particles penetrate walls and fabrics, causing persistent odors.
- Incomplete ventilation during or after a fire leaves smoke smell behind.
- Burning tobacco products release tar and acids that cling to surfaces.
- Fire damage causes soot residues that emit unpleasant odors over time.
- Moisture combined with smoke intensifies odor retention in building materials.

Our Work Process
- Inspect affected areas to assess the smoke odor source and damage severity.
- Apply specialized ozone or thermal fogging equipment to neutralize odors.
- Deep clean and treat walls, upholstery, and HVAC systems to remove residues.
- Monitor odor levels through follow-up visits ensuring complete remediation.
- Conduct final walkthrough and offer tips to prevent future smoke-related smells.

How Long Does Smoke Odor Removal Typically Take?
Most smoke odor removal projects take between one to three days depending on the space size and contamination level, with attention to thoroughness and safety throughout.
Are The Chemicals Used In Smoke Odor Removal Safe For Pets And Children?
We use environmentally friendly and EPA-approved products designed to be safe for pets and children when applied by trained professionals.
Can Smoke Odor Be Completely Removed From Porous Materials?
While porous materials like carpets and drapes can be challenging, advanced cleaning and deodorizing techniques often successfully eliminate most odors; replacement may be necessary in severe cases.
Does Homeowner’s Insurance Usually Cover Smoke Odor Removal Costs?
Coverage varies by policy, but many homeowner’s insurance plans include smoke odor removal related to fire damage; contacting your insurer is recommended for details.
